Telegram
Telegram offers a unique blend of speed and security with its cloud-based messaging service. It’s particularly favored for its channels feature that allows users to broadcast messages to unlimited audiences—a great tool for businesses or content creators. Additionally, Telegram supports stickers and bots that can enhance your chatting experience while providing a platform for community building.
Signal
Signal has gained popularity as a privacy-focused messaging app that champions user confidentiality above all else. With features like disappearing messages and encrypted calls, Signal provides peace of mind when sharing sensitive information. It’s an excellent choice for users who prioritize security without sacrificing functionality.
Slack
Slack is tailored specifically for teams and organizations looking to enhance their collaboration efforts through efficient communication tools. Its channel system helps keep discussions organized by topic or project, making it easier to manage team workflows. Slack integrates with various third-party apps which means you can streamline your tasks without leaving the platform.
Discord
Originally designed for gamers, Discord has evolved into a versatile platform used by communities across diverse interests—from book clubs to study groups. Its voice channels allow real-time conversation while text channels enable organized discussions on multiple topics simultaneously—making it perfect for fostering community engagement.
